214.68 214.68(1) (1) A federal savings bank or federal savings and loan association may convert itself into a savings bank, and a savings bank may convert itself into a federal savings bank, by following the procedures under pars.
(a)to (e) .
214.68(1)(a) (a) A meeting of the members or stockholders shall be held after not less than 10 days’ written notice to each member or stockholder, served either personally or by mail to the last-known post-office address. The notice shall state the date, time, place and purpose of the meeting.
